Dharakheda Gram Panchayat, Mahidpur
Dharakheda is a Gram Panchayat located in the Ujjain district of Madhya Pradesh. It falls under the Mahidpur Janpad Panchayat and Ujjain Zila Panchayat. Dharakheda Gram Panchayat covers a total of 2 villages: Bagla and Dharakheda. It is headed by an elected Sarpanch, while administrative work is handled by the Panchayat Secretary.

Panchayati Raj Structure for Dharakheda Gram Panchayat
Dharakheda Gram Panchayat is part of Madhya Pradesh's three-tier Panchayati Raj structure. The three levels are described below.
Tier 1: Gram Panchayat (GP)
Dharakheda Gram Panchayat is the village-level Panchayati Raj institution. It handles local development and basic civic services such as drinking water, sanitation, street lighting and village infrastructure.
Tier 2: Block Panchayat (BP)
Mahidpur Janpad Panchayat is the intermediate-level Panchayati Raj institution for Dharakheda Gram Panchayat. It coordinates development activities across Gram Panchayats in its area.
Tier 3: District Panchayat (DP)
Ujjain Zila Panchayat is the district-level Panchayati Raj institution for Dharakheda Gram Panchayat. It coordinates development planning and activities at the district level.
